Management response from
oyvindeikaas, General Manager

Thank you for your review! You are of course not the only one who have complained about the noice from our nicht club "NightCap" and "Africa Bar". From the 1st of January 2009, these night clubs is closed permanently. During this year, the hotel will be renovated, and the areas will be converted into conference facilities.
